General Notes (Husband)

[bobspu.ged]

BIO: In answer to a questionnaire from compiler about 1995, Emma (PFEIFFER) GILCHRIST reported that her father, John C. PFEIFFER was born 02 July 1861 in PENNSYLVANIA. She also provided his date and place of death on that questionnaire. Several years later (about 1996), Emma's son-in-law, J. Michael FROST, began doing genealogical research. Late that year, "Mike" shared much of the data he had collected from interviews with Emma and her husband, Byron GILCHRIST, with compiler. There were several discrepancies between the data given to Mike and that given to compiler at the earlier time. After Emma's death in January, 1997, compiler examined the microfilm for the 1920 census in Marshall County, IN. That record states that John C. PFEIFFER was born in INDIANA. The informant also reported that John's mother was born in PENNSYLVANIA. Which of these records is accurate is unknown. Per the 1920 census, John C. was 58 years of age and a farmer; the residence was listed as "Rented." Still residing with their parents were Sylvester S., 23, Anna,18 and Emma, 13. Sylvester's occupation was listed as "carpenter."

General Notes (Wife)

[bobspu.ged]

BIO: The data on "Elscinda" STANLEY has been collected from reports of her daughter, Emma. The data given, however, is not always consistent from one interview/questionnaire to another. Emma did not provide the spelling for "El" PFEIFFER's given name, but upon seeing it spelled "Elscinda", she did not comment that it was not correct. The 1920 census shows the name "Ellcinda"; a notation concerning the grave of her son in Vol. 4 of the Fulton County Cemetery Inscriptions compilation shows "Ellcinda"; Emma's death certificate shows her mother's name as "Ellacinda." Which of these spellings is correct is not known. Per the 1920 census, "Ellcinda" was 52 years of age (this does not agree with the "1966" year of birth provided in earlier data from Emma); she was born in INDIANA. Her father and mother were reported to have been born in OHIO and INDIANA respectively. At the time of the 1920 enumeration (January, 1920), Sylvester S., 23, Anna, 18 and Emma, 13, were still living in their parents' home. An older son, Forest, was enumerated in E.D. #173 in his own household, as was another son, Oliver PFEIFFER. Compiler failed to look for the PFEIFFERs' other daughter, Viola, on the 1920 census.

BIO: Compiler requested that Emma (PFEIFFER) GILCHRIST send information re her early life in Marshall County, IN. The following is a synopsis of a letter Emma wrote in response to this request in October, 1995. Compiler has taken the liberty of reorganizing the information contained in that letter to group chronological events where possible:

"I cannot tell much about my background. I was born in Marshall Co., IN about five miles west of Bremen. That area must have been swampy; I'm not sure if the spot where we lived was called Jackson Island or an area south" (of there) "where there was a farm called 'The Section.' My Dad helped build a barn"; (there) "a new house was to have been built a little later, but the owner died...On the new barn a good swing was put up for me. There was a good apple orchard; some years" (we had) "apples to sell. There was quite a number of children for play; 'good neighbors for harvesting and butchering help. 'Went about three miles to school in a 'kid hack' drawn by horses...winter time a sled." ("kid hack" probably refers to an early type of school bus.) (The school was) "...one room... We moved to another farm east of Bremen, 1< miles where we lived till I was 15 or 16...After we moved east I walked;" (to school) "'one room also, but much smaller; then into town for H.S. (high school), walking also, till we moved." (again) "Then it was 5 or 6 blocks. West of town is where I had my first car ride. A neighbor bought a car and all the kids got a ride in it from the salesman; we were about three deep in the back seat. East of town we ran to see an airplane go over; west of town" (we had) "our first telephone;" (then we had) "electricity and" (indoor) "bathroom after."(moving into town) Threshing day was quite an event; 'dinner for the kids or sometimes we could go to play and have noon time dinner, after all the men had eaten but the food was wonderful and plentiful. South of us were peppermint farms. Some fortunes were made till the black, muck soil ran out of something mint needs. In summertime boys on their hands and knees could pull weeds - hot, dirty work, but some money to help buy clothes and school books...(for) some (it) even (helped) with college... Part of our play dishes were the white things from old fashioned can lids; 'most anything that looked like cookware. There were geese at one time till the gander got after me...We went barefoot all summer; then had the ordeal of foot washing before bed. Mother's mother" (Eliza MORRIS) "came to our house part time about then and I have her dining room table that she brought with her. I was told it was made from walnut from a chest someone brought from England or where ever. My Dad did some work on it so all seven kids could get around it... When I was seven or eight a neighbor girl got Brights disease and died; 'my first experience with death... ...I was kind of "poorly" then. A neighbor man came one morning at sunrise, bundled me up from the cold then took me outside to look at the sun. He said something for a cure. I must have hated what he did for I was always threatened (with) they'd call him. The cure seems to have kept me a long time... There was a huckster who gave a stick of candy; one day a prune or some such - 'made a broken heart. 'Christmas was an orange, a sack of hard candy from church and school; 'one year a doll who went to sleep and was ruined in the farm house fire. This is enough for now.

Love, Emma and Byron

This has not been proof read so it may not make any sense; just pretend we are talking." (And compiler DID "just pretend we were talking.") ------------------------------------------------------------ By the time Emma entered Bremen High School, her parents had moved into the town of Bremen. They lived in the northeast section where BONDURANTS and CRIPES were neighbors. This house had electricity and indoor plumbing. The family were joined the Salem Evangelical Church in Bremen. During high school years, Emma worked at Schlosser Brothers Creamery. She graduated as Salutatorian of her class at Bremen High School. After graduation, she worked as a teller in the Bremen State Bank until she married. Byron and Emma met on a blind date arranged by Emma's sister Anna and her husband. Byron was boarding in the home of James STANLEY, Emma's uncle. Anna had met Byron during visits to the STANLEY home, and she decided that Emma should meet him. They were married on August 18, 1928 in the church parsonage by Rev. KALEY, who was also the father of one of Emma's friends. They purchased a home on South Fellow Street in South Bend, where they lived for several years. After their retirement, the GILCHRISTs moved from their home in South Bend, IN to their farm in Argos (Marshall County) IN. A few years later, a wiring problem in the T.V. ignited a fire in the farm house. The house was damaged. The farm was sold, and the couple had a new home built on State Road 10 just west of U.S. 31. This was the fire that Emma refers to in talking about the doll in her letter. Apparently, that doll had survived many, many years! The reference to the Civil War Veteran who was an ancestor of Emma's was a brother to Eliza MORRIS and a great uncle of Emma's. Compiler requested veterans files (from National Archives, Nov. 1, 1995) on Cornelius MORRIS, a Union soldier who resided in Wakarusa, IN with his wife, Sally. Emma remembered him coming to their house "...in summertime... Mom always wanted him to play the fiddle, "Marching Through Georgia." Friday, 13 December 1996, Emma was taken to St. Vincent's Hospital in Indianapolis with congestive heart failure; she "celebrated" her 90th birthday there. She was moved from the hospital to the nursing center section of American Village, where she and Byron had their independent living apartment. After regaining her strength, she was returned to their apartment in early January, and on 12 January 1997, she was reported to be progressing well. Wednesday, 15 January 1997, Emma's son-in-law, J. Michael FROST, called compiler to inform her of Emma's death at 4:00 a.m. that day. Emma had suffered a severe stroke on Monday, then developed pneumonia. She never regained consciousness. ----------------------------------------------------------- Emma GILCHRIST died at St. Vincent's Hospital in Indianapolis, IN.
